The distance travelled by a particle starting from rest and moving with an acceleration 4/3 m/s², in the third second is -
A
10/3 m
B
19/3 m
C
6 m
D
4 m
Correct Answer
Option A
Detailed Explanation
The distance traveled in the nth second is given by sₙ = u + a/2 (2n - 1). For u = 0, a = 4/3 m/s², and n = 3, s₃ =⁰⁺ (4/3)/2 (5) = 10/3 m.
